IC Cards (Suica / PASMO)

Mobile IC Card (For iPhone Users): For users of iPhone, setting up a Welcome Suica Mobile is the most convenient method. You can recharge it instantly using the credit cards registered in your Apple Wallet. It expires 180 days after issue.
  • - Physical Card (Recommended Alternative): If you do not have a compatible iPhone or prefer a physical card, we recommend purchasing a Welcome Suica. This is special IC cards for tourists (no deposit required, valid for 28 days) available at vending machines or counters at Narita and Haneda airports.     If you want a card with no expiration date, you can choose to purchase a standard Suica or Pasmo card. Standard Suica cards can be purchased and recharged at station ticket machines. While a ¥500 deposit is required, there is no need to worry about the card expiring, and you can use it again on future visits to Japan.
